我想在后台播放音频。
所以我在主要项目中做了这个
BackgroundAudioPlayer.Instance.Track = audioTrack;
BackgroundAudioPlayer.Instance.Play();
和内部音频背景代理:
protected override void OnUserAction(BackgroundAudioPlayer player, AudioTrack track, UserAction action, object param)
{
switch (action)
{
case UserAction.Play:
player.Play();
break;
case UserAction.Stop:
player.Stop();
break;
case UserAction.Pause:
player.Pause();
break;
case UserAction.FastForward:
player.FastForward();
break;
case UserAction.Rewind:
player.Rewind();
break;
default:
break;
}
NotifyComplete();
}
但我得到一个错误:
System.SystemException: HRESULT = 0xC00D001A
我也有另一个问题:关闭应用程序后,这种情况会继续播放吗?
最佳答案
关于c# - 尝试在音频播放代理中播放音频时出错。 System.SystemException:HRESULT = 0xC00D001A,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20564293/